Yoga Therapy

Yoga therapy applies the physical practice of yoga, often including meditation and breathing practice, to health conditions including shoulder and back pain, high blood pressure, fibromyalgia, multiple sclerosis, and more. It doesn't replace your current doctors, treatments, and medications. Instead, it works alongside them.

According to Yoga as Medicine: The yogic prescription for health and healing by Timothy McCall, M.D., this is a partial list of health conditions shown by scientific studies to benefit from the practice of yoga: He also lists 40 ways that yoga heals:
  1. increases flexibility
  2. strengthens muscles
  3. improves balance
  4. improves immune function
  5. improves posture
  6. improves lung function
  7. leads to slower and deeper breathing
  8. discourages mouth breathing
  9. increases oxygenation of tissues
  10. improves joint health
  11. nourishes intervertebral disks
  12. improves return of venous blood
  13. increases circulation of lymph
  14. improves function of the feet
  15. improves proprioception
  16. increases control of bodily functions
  17. strengthens bones
  18. conditions the cardiovascular system
  19. promotes weight loss
  20. relaxes the nervous system
  21. improves the function of the nervous system
  22. improves brain function
  23. activates the left prefontal cortex
  24. changes neurotransmitter levels
  25. lowers levels of the stress hormone cortisol
  26. lowers blood sugar
  27. lowers blood pressure
  28. improves levels of cholesterol and triglycerides
  29. thins the blood
  30. improves bowel function
  31. releases unconscious muscular gripping
  32. uses imagery to effect change in the body
  33. relieves pain
  34. lowers need for medication
  35. fosters healing relationships
  36. improves psychological health
  37. leads to healthier habits
  38. fosters spiritual growth
  39. elicits the placebo effect
  40. encourages involvement in your own healing
